Tree Edging Installation in Citrus County, FL
Tree edging installation involves creating a defined border around trees to enhance landscape appearance and prevent grass or mulch from encroaching on the root zone. This service typically covers projects such as installing durable edging materials around mature trees, new plantings, or landscaped beds that feature trees. Property owners often want to understand the types of edging options available, how the installation can improve curb appeal, and what maintenance might be required to keep the borders looking neat over time.
Before requesting tree edging services, homeowners should consider the size and type of trees, as well as the overall landscape design. It’s helpful to know whether the goal is to contain mulch, create a clean visual separation, or protect tree roots from lawn equipment. Clarifying these details can assist in selecting the most suitable edging materials and styles to complement the property’s aesthetic and functional needs.

Tree Edging Installation Questions
What is tree edging installation? Tree edging installation involves creating a defined border around a tree to enhance appearance and prevent grass or weeds from encroaching on the root zone.
What materials are used for tree edging? Common materials include metal, plastic, stone, or wood, chosen to match the landscape and durability needs of the property.
Why should property owners consider tree edging? Edging helps improve curb appeal, defines planting areas, and protects roots from damage caused by lawn equipment or foot traffic.
What types of trees benefit from edging? Most trees, especially those with exposed roots or in landscaped beds, can benefit from edging to maintain a tidy appearance and protect the root zone.
